    Description

    Release Date: 10 May 2004

    Acclaimed Director John Huston's (The African Queen, The Maltese Falcon, Key Largo) authorative, masterly version of Herman Melville's fabled novel is cinema at its most spectacular.

    Intelligently adapted by Novelist Ray Bradbury, Moby Dick draws upon the narration of the surviving shipmate of a terrible tragedy to tell the classic tale of Captain Ahab's (Gregory Peck) obsessive hunt for the great white whale that has dictated his destiny ever since leaving him a peg-legged cripple. In a perilous journey that will take Ahab and his crew to the ends of the earth, no sacrifice is too great in Ahab's thirst for bloody revenge.

    Stunningly shot and impressively staged - Moby Dick is an exciting, epic work bolstered by first rate performances (as Father Mapple Orson Welles delivers a charismatic, show-stopping cameo) and Huston's audacious vision.
